Abstract

PROBLEM TO BE SOLVED: To prevent powder from leaking and flowing out of a rear surface of a bottom label at a blow port side and of the blow port in a multi-layer paper bag having a blow port side bottom adhering section. SOLUTION: There is provided a multi-layer paper bag in which a first score folding section x, a second score folding section y and a slant score folding section z are folded at a first score 12, a second score 13 and a slant score 11 and a blown side bottom adhering section A is formed. A vertical slit 7 is cut at the second score folding section y to form a vertical folding-back section 7a and a valve paper 4 is overlapped on the lower surface of the overlapped sections of the second score folding sections y, y. A blow port 3 is formed among the first score folding sections x, x and the slant score folding section z. A hot melt hm4 is coated on the surface of the valve paper 4 at the side of the blow port 3. After filling contents in the multi-layer paper bag 1, the hot melt hm6 of the bottom label 6 and the hot melt hm4 of the valve paper 4 are thermally pressed to the surface of the blow port 3 of the valve paper 4, thereby both inside and outside of the blow port 3 are double sealed. Accordingly, the content is filled to enable power leakage and blowoff of powder can be prevented.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a bottom-attached multilayer bag with a blow-out port for heavy packaging.

2. Description of the Related Art As shown in FIGS. 13 to 17 of Japanese Utility Model Publication No. Hei 1-2666000, a conventional bottom-attached multilayer bag with a blowing port of this type of packaging bag has a valve paper directly adhered to the bottom bonding portion of the blowing port. Therefore, the thickness of the blow-out portion has a multilayer thickness.

[0003] For this reason, when rolling is performed by a roller for attaching decorative paper, there is a problem that the pressure of the roller does not reach the valve paper, and the adhesive between the valve paper and the decorative paper is not sufficient. As a result, the powder may leak from the blowing port and cause dusting.
